Transaction a4be64ea101ab74676a268afcdcbde68f5bd9b0090c6f8ea0b91994af9737d24
1 Input
2 Outputs
- a4be64ea101ab74676a268afcdcbde68f5bd9b0090c6f8ea0b91994af9737d24:0
- a4be64ea101ab74676a268afcdcbde68f5bd9b0090c6f8ea0b91994af9737d24:1
value 4384615
address 3738qQohYp8CvcAFHqM7vpxPk2H5iT3iNp
value 986786184
address 3M9JiDkKUWqs6Auvbnc16oP7FCKcPRWa75